The Challenge

The current Fluxx dashboard is the front door to a global grantmaking platform, helping foundations and grantmakers manage complex funding workflows at scale.

As the product evolved, the dashboard experience became fragmented; users struggled to find priorities, navigate workflows, and quickly understand what needed attention.

I led the end-to-end redesign, transforming the dashboard into a modern, widget-based workspace that became the foundation for the next generation of the enterprise platform.

What Customers Said

  1. “I’m constantly being asked by our Director where to find things in Fluxx. It takes away a lot of time from my day-to-day work.”

  2. “I want to spend my time on-site with our grantees, not spending hours working in Fluxx.”

  3. “It’s frustrating to come into the system every few weeks and feel like I have to relearn how to use it.”

  4. “I want a product that everyone in my organization will adopt with ease.”

Primary Goal

Build a modern enterprise workspace that helps users quickly understand what requires their attention while providing flexible entry points into the work they perform every day.

Design Principles

Four principles informed every design decision:

Prioritize work, not navigation
Users should immediately understand what requires attention without searching across the application.

Adapt to different workflows
Different roles have different priorities. The dashboard should feel personalized while remaining consistent.

Design for growth
The dashboard needed to support future capabilities without requiring another redesign. Saving time and money on Engineering resources.

Reduce cognitive load
Clear hierarchy, progressive disclosure, and focused widgets help users process information more efficiently.

Building for Scale

The dashboard redesign became the foundation for a broader enterprise platform modernization. To evolve a complex product, we needed a repeatable system. Not just a one-time redesign. I partnered closely with Engineering to create a modular component architecture and scalable design system that enabled faster, more consistent product development.

How we built for scale:

  • Created reusable components: Built a widget-based architecture with Engineering to support future product expansion.

  • Aligned design and code: Established patterns that connected the design system directly to the production codebase.

  • Improved team velocity: Reduced repeated design and development efforts through shared components and workflows.

  • Integrated AI-assisted workflows: Used AI to accelerate component creation, identify UI gaps, and align new features with existing patterns.

  • Established a foundation for growth: Enabled teams to build new experiences faster while maintaining consistency across the platform.
